  • Along with changes in the condition conservation river , change the area and population growth is make a river not function optimally as well as it should , so as to from such change is the disaster especially flood that results in many loss , in the form of fatalities or loss wealth .River Ciujung is river in banten , several segments of this river often overflow , exactly at city rangkasbitung kecamatan lebak , their muara Ciujung , river Ciujung in urban areas rangkasbitung have broad catchment area more or less 523,157 km2 .This study attempts to determine the cause of flood that is there rangkasbitung kecamatan lebak , based on capacity or capacity river , with discharge occurring .And gave the alternative solution from trouble the flood. In this research the data used was secondary data of rainfall daily for 19 years and data dimensions was latitudes Sub bassin Ciujung . The results of the ordinal rain plans with period of 100 years = 140,12 mm , rain per an hour with the methods ABM, alternative block methode, lasts six hours with duration the crest on hours to 3 = 76.43 mm while discharge plan with the HSS SCS methode obtained value discharge the top of 1266,335 m3 / s , as for by using the HSS Snyder methode obtained value discharge the top of 1591,399 m3 / s , after value discharge known , the ordinal continued uses software to know capacity river , after analyzed use the currents steady flow and the flow of unsteady flow Sub bassin Ciujung can not accommodate discharge the flow of occurring , for that reason need of maintenance river of normalization river , or alternate another so that the flow of water may be accommodated by Sub bassin Ciujung .
